Selena Gomez Prefers Older Men

Singer Selena Gomez has revealed that she would love to date older men.
 
The 23-year-old singer, who had an on/off four-year-relationship with Justin Bieber, 21, says she is self-conscious about looking younger than she is because she is attracted to older men, reports mirror.co.uk.
 
"I hate it. It's hard and I'm weirded out by the idea that a guy has Googled me before we meet, and that has happened. I feel like I look 16 sometimes, which is a bummer because I would love to date older guys,” In Style magazine quoted Gomez as saying.
 
However, she would make an exception for one person who is closer to her own age -- former One Direction singer Zayn Malik.
 
"If he had asked me out on a date, I would be seen with him. Just kidding, but not kidding,” she added.
